From: Assessment of Parkinsonian gait in older adults with dementia via human pose tracking in video data
 | Study Participants (n = 14) Mean ± SD | |
Age | 76.2 ± 8.7 | |
Sex (% male) | 57.1 | |
Number of Walks | 28.6 ± 11.8 | |
Total Severe Impairment Battery (SIB) Score | 27.9 ± 13.1 | |
Total Neuropsychiatric Inventory (NPI) Score | 46.3 ± 19.5 | |
Total Katz Index of Independence in Activities of Daily Living Score | 2.3 ± 1.3 | |
Total Tinetti POMA Balance Score | 9.9 ± 3.1 | |
Total Tinetti POMA Gait Score | 8.4 ± 2.8 | |
Antipsychotic Medication Use | Study Participants Prescribed Medication (n = 14) | Daily Dose (mg) Mean ± SD |
Risperidone | 3 (21.4%) | 0.5 ± 0.4 |
Quetiapine | 11 (78.6%) | 64.2 ± 61.8 |
Clozapine | 2 (14.3%) | 32.4 ± 7.2 |
Loxapine | 5 (35.7%) | 5.5 ± 1.1 |
Olanzapine | 2 (14.3%) | 1.9 ± 0.9 |
Nozinan | 2 (14.3%) | 12.8 ± 3.8 |
